About The Position

We are seeking a talented and experienced Catering Manager to join our team. As a Catering Manager, you will be responsible for planning, coordinating, and executing catering events, ensuring the highest levels of guest satisfaction and successful event execution.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in hospitality management, Event Planning, or a related field is preferred.
  • Previous experience in catering or event management is required, with a strong track record of successfully executing a variety of events.
  • Exceptional organizational and project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ple events simultaneously.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build and maintain client relationships effectively.
  • Proficiency in event planning software and Microsoft Office applications.
  • Problem-solving abilities and the capacity to handle challenging situations with professionalism.
  • Flexibility to work evenings, weekends, and holidays based on event schedules.

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with clients to understand their event needs, preferences, and budget constraints, and assist in the creation of tailored event proposals.
  • Work with the culinary team to design and customize menus that meet the client's requirements and align with the restaurant's offerings.
  • Oversee all aspects of catering events, including staffing, logistics, equipment rentals, and vendor coordination.
  • Maintain clear and prompt communication with clients to confirm event details, address concerns, and provide updates throughout the planning process.
  • Create and manage event budgets, track expenses, and ensure profitability while minimizing waste and maximizing efficiency.
  • Lead catering events, ensuring that all elements are executed seamlessly, and guests receive exceptional service.
  • Monitor food and beverage quality, presentation, and service standards to ensure consistency and adherence to restaurant policies.
